Overview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T

Oflobid 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ets are an antibacterial medication combating bacterial infections. This antibiotic is effective against infections affecting the urinary tract, sinuses, throat, skin, soft tissues, and lungs (including pneumonia). Its mechanism involves halting bacterial proliferation, thus resolving the infection. Always adhere to your physician's prescribed dosage and duration for Oflobid 100mg DT. Administer the medication with or without food, ideally at the same time each day. Complete the entire course of treatment, even if symptoms improve; avoid missed doses. Nausea and abdominal discomfort are potential side effects, typically transient and self-limiting. However, persistent or bothersome symptoms warrant medical consultation. Diarrhea is another possible side effect, usually resolving upon treatment completion; report persistent diarrhea or bloody stools to your doctor. Prior allergies to any Oflobid components necessitate avoidance. Seek immediate medical assistance should a severe allergic reaction, characterized by rash, facial or lingual swelling, dyspnea, or respiratory difficulty, occur. Disclose any history of kidney problems to your doctor before commencing treatment.

How to use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T:

Administer this medication according to your physician's prescribed dosage and schedule. Dissolve the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T in water before ingestion. Consumption may coincide with meals or be taken independently; however, consistent timing is recommended.

How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T works:

Oflobid 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ets contain an antibiotic that inhibits bacterial DNA-gyrase, an enzyme crucial for bacterial replication and repair. This mechanism of action ultimately leads to bacterial cell death.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T and alcohol is inadvisable.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Oflobid 100mg DT t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Oflobid 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available data from humans ind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ving may be unsafe while taking Oflobid 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ets due to potential drowsiness, visual disturbances, and dizziness. Avoid operating a vehicle if these side effects develop.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Use Oflobid 100mg Delayed-Release Tablets cautiously in individuals with impaired renal function.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Oflobid 100mg extended-release tablets cautiously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T :

Should you forget to take your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T, administer the dose immediately upon remembering. However,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Never take a double dose.

FAQs on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T

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T can cause diarrhea as a side effect. This is because, while it eliminates harmful bacteria, it can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ria. Consult your doctor if you experience severe diarrhea.
Continue taking your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T as prescribed; finish the entire course, even if you feel better. Complete symptom relief doesn't always mean the infection is gone.
Yes, Oflobid 100mg Tablet DT can increase the risk of muscle damage, particularly in the Achilles tendon. This risk exists for all ages. Report any muscle pain to your doctor while taking this medication.
